Перестановки (2)
Дана строка, состоящая из M (2 ≤ M ≤ 8) символов (буквы латинского алфавита и цифры). Вывести все перестановки символов данной строки.
Технические условия
Входные данные
В первой строке файла находится исходная строка.
Выходные данные
Вывести в каждой строке файла по одной перестановке. Перестановки можно выводить в любом порядке. Повторений и строк, не являющихся перестановками исходной, быть не должно.
Информация о задаче
Лимит времени: 1 секундаЛимит памяти: 64 MB
Баллы за пройденный тест: 16.6667
Сложность: 17% 82/99
Пример
Пример входных данныхSample 1 AB Sample 2 122 |
Пример выходных данныхSample 1 AB BA Sample 2 122 212 221 |
| ← Разложение на простые множители | Список задач | Копилка → |
